Indonesian Company Selects Sultex Weaving Machines

PT Unggulrejo Wasono, Indonesia, recently purchased 30 Sulzer Textil G6500 rapier weaving machines
from Switzerland-based Sultex Ltd. Established in 1979, PT Unggulrejo weaves fabrics in a 2-hectare
facility and exports 40 percent of the fabric produced.

“We opted for the G6500 because of its high performance, its versatility, its reliability and
the excellent fabric quality,” said Martin Lukas, director, PT Unggulrejo. “In addition, with
Sultex we have a superb partner with outstanding local technical support. With this machine, we
will enhance our exports of high-value-added dobby fabrics for the apparel segment.”
